Comforting and Easy Cheesy White Bean Tomato Bake Recipe
Introduction
This comforting and easy cheesy white bean tomato bake combines tender cannellini beans with a flavorful tomato sauce and melted cheese for a hearty, satisfying meal. Perfect for busy weeknights, it’s simple to prepare and full of cozy flavors that everyone will enjoy.

Ingredients
- 2 tablespoons olive oil (30ml)
- 1 medium onion, diced
- 3 garlic cloves, minced
- 2 cans (15 oz each) cannellini beans, drained and rinsed
- 1 can (15 oz / 425g) crushed tomatoes
- ½ teaspoon dried oregano
- ½ teaspoon dried basil
- Salt and pepper to taste
- 1¼ cups shredded mozzarella cheese (150g)
- ¼ cup grated Parmesan cheese (25g)
- Fresh basil or parsley, chopped (optional, for garnish)
Instructions
- Step 1: Preheat your oven to 375°F (190°C).
- Step 2: Heat olive oil in a skillet over medium heat. Add the diced onion and sauté for 4–5 minutes until soft and translucent.
- Step 3: Stir in the minced garlic and cook for another minute until fragrant.
- Step 4: Add crushed tomatoes, dried oregano, dried basil, salt, and pepper. Let the sauce simmer gently for 5 minutes to blend the flavors.
- Step 5: Stir in the drained cannellini beans and cook for 2–3 more minutes to heat through.
- Step 6: Transfer the mixture to a greased 9×9-inch baking dish. Sprinkle the shredded mozzarella and grated Parmesan evenly over the top.
- Step 7: Bake in the preheated oven for 20–25 minutes until the cheese is bubbly and golden brown. Let it rest a few minutes before garnishing with fresh basil or parsley and serving.
Tips & Variations
- Use fresh herbs like thyme or rosemary for a different aromatic twist.
- For a vegan version, substitute dairy cheese with plant-based cheese alternatives.
- Add a pinch of red chili flakes to the sauce if you like a bit of heat.
- This bake pairs wonderfully with a side of crusty bread or a simple green salad.
Storage
Store leftovers in an airtight container in the refrigerator for up to 3 days. Reheat in the oven at 350°F (175°C) until warmed through or microwave on medium power in short bursts, stirring occasionally to heat evenly.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use other types of beans in this recipe?
Yes, navy beans or great northern beans can be good substitutes if you don’t have cannellini beans on hand. Just make sure to drain and rinse them before using.
How do I prevent the cheese from over-browning?
If the cheese starts to brown too quickly, you can loosely cover the baking dish with aluminum foil partway through baking to protect the top while the dish finishes heating.
PrintComforting and Easy Cheesy White Bean Tomato Bake Recipe
This comforting and easy cheesy white bean tomato bake features a savory blend of sautéed onions, garlic, cannellini beans, and crushed tomatoes, topped with melted mozzarella and Parmesan cheese. It’s a hearty and delicious vegetarian dish perfect for a cozy dinner, offering a satisfying combination of creamy beans and savory tomato sauce baked to golden perfection.
- Prep Time: 10 minutes
- Cook Time: 35 minutes
- Total Time: 45 minutes
- Yield: 4 servings 1x
- Category: Main Course
- Method: Baking
- Cuisine: Italian
- Diet: Vegetarian
Ingredients
Main Ingredients
- 2 tablespoons olive oil (30ml)
- 1 medium onion, diced
- 3 garlic cloves, minced
- 2 cans (15 oz each) cannellini beans, drained and rinsed
- 1 can (15 oz / 425g) crushed tomatoes
- ½ teaspoon dried oregano
- ½ teaspoon dried basil
- Salt and pepper to taste
- 1¼ cups shredded mozzarella cheese (150g)
- ¼ cup grated Parmesan cheese (25g)
Garnish
- Fresh basil or parsley, chopped (optional)
Instructions
- Preheat the oven: Set your oven to 375°F (190°C) to prepare for baking the dish later.
- Sauté the onion: Heat the olive oil in a skillet over medium heat. Add the diced onion and cook for 4–5 minutes until softened and translucent.
- Add garlic: Stir in the minced garlic and continue cooking for an additional 1 minute until fragrant, being careful not to burn it.
- Simmer the sauce: Add the crushed tomatoes, dried oregano, dried basil, salt, and pepper to the skillet. Let the mixture simmer gently for 5 minutes to blend the flavors.
- Add beans: Stir in the drained cannellini beans and cook for 2–3 minutes to warm through and coat evenly with the sauce.
- Assemble in baking dish: Transfer the bean and tomato mixture into a greased 9×9-inch baking dish, spreading it evenly.
- Add cheeses: Sprinkle the shredded mozzarella and grated Parmesan evenly over the top of the dish.
- Bake: Place the baking dish in the preheated oven and bake for 20–25 minutes, until the cheese is bubbly and golden brown on top.
- Rest and garnish: Remove from the oven and let the dish sit for a few minutes before garnishing with chopped fresh basil or parsley, if desired, and serving.
Notes
- You can substitute cannellini beans with great northern beans if preferred.
- For extra flavor, add a pinch of red pepper flakes during the simmer step.
- This dish pairs well with a side of crusty bread or a simple green salad.
- Leftovers can be refrigerated for up to 3 days and reheated in the oven or microwave.
Keywords: cheesy white bean bake, vegetarian white bean casserole, tomato bean bake, easy vegetarian dinner, cannellini beans recipe, baked mozzarella dish

